FUNCTIONAL DESCRIPTION
The MX4-1000TX series combines four copper Ethernet ports. MX4-1000TX units allow transmission
speeds of 10 Mb/s, 100Mb/s, or 1000 Mb/s on each of the copper ports. Refer to the data sheets for
detailed performance specifications.
The MX4-1000TX series is configured to auto negotiate the data ports to either 10Base-T, 100Base-TX,
or 1000Base-TX Ethernet data at full or half duplex. The auto negotiate feature also selects the proper
MDI or MDIX interface.
This unit is contained in a compact and rugged aluminum housing with internal dc voltage regulation.
The detachable terminal block, RJ45 Ethernet data connector, and LED indicators provide for easy
installation and monitoring of data and dc power. The MX4 series is designed for mounting as a
modular stand alone unit. For rack mounting in the MXRC-1 subrack see the MXR4 series.
INSTALLATION
THIS INSTALLATION SHOULD BE MADE BY A QUALIFIED SERVICE PERSON AND SHOULD
CONFORM TO THE NATIONAL ELECTRICAL CODE, ANSI/NFPA 70 AND LOCAL CODES.
Mount the MX4-1000TX unit to a secure surface using #8 (3mm) hardware in four places. See the
drawing on the next page for mounting dimensions.
